The fourth installment in the irresistible New York Times bestselling mystery series featuring canine narrator Chet and his human companion Berniethe coolest human/pooch duo this side of Wallace and Gromit (Kirkus Reviews).Humor and intrigue combine for a thoroughly entertaining comic mystery (Booklist) as Spencer Quinns engaging and unlikely team of crime solvers takes on the case of a boy gone missing from a wilderness camp.The kids mother thinks her exhusband snatched their son, but Chets always reliable nose leads Bernie in a new and dangerous direction. Meanwhile, matters at home get complicated when a stray puppy that looks suspiciously like Chet shows up. Affairs of the heart collide with a job thats never been tougher, requiring our intrepid sleuths to trust each other even when circumstancesand a rival P.I.conspire to keep them far apart.
